Nicolas: scrolling=no im stylesheet für body ?

Hallo Leute,

wie kann ich in StyleSheets die Scroolbars abschalten, damit ich denselben Effekt erziele wie bei Frames (scrolling=no) ?

Nicolas

  1. Hallo Nicolas!

    wie kann ich in StyleSheets die Scroolbars abschalten, damit ich denselben Effekt erziele wie bei Frames (scrolling=no) ?

    Gar nicht. Die Scrollbars für Dokument respektive Body kommen vom Browser und nicht vom CSS. Wenn du das abstellen willst, dann eben mir Frames.

    Folgendes könnte theoretisch gehen, aber ich zweifele, daß die Borwser es mitmachen:

    body {
    position:absolute;
    top:0;
    right:0;
    bottom:0;
    left:0;
    width:100%;
    height:100%;
    overflow:hidden;
    }

    Grüße
    Thomas

    1. Hallo Thomas,

      Folgendes könnte theoretisch gehen, aber ich zweifele, daß die Borwser es mitmachen:

      body {
      position:absolute;
      top:0;
      right:0;
      bottom:0;
      left:0;
      width:100%;
      height:100%;
      overflow:hidden;

      overflow geht klasse für den Nav4.51. IE4 ignoriert es. Für den habe ich aber in den normalen body-tag scroll="no" eingesetzt. Ist zwar kein CSS, aber besser als nix.

      width:100% bewirkt einen unschönen sehr breiten rechten Rand von ca. 150pixeln. Habe ich deshalb weggelassen.
      top,right, bottom ... geht auch nur für Nav. Für IE habe deshalb ins Stylesheet
      body { margin-width:0px; margin-height:0px; margin-left:0px; margin-right:0px; margin-top:0px;} verwendet.

      Das overflow kenne ich noch nicht, wozu ist das genau gut ?

      Dank Dir Thomas und Grüße
      Nicolas

      1. Hallo Nicolas!

        overflow geht klasse für den Nav4.51.

        Das wundert mich aber.

        top,right, bottom ... geht auch nur für Nav.

        Nein. top und left kennt der NS und IE4, bottom kennt der IE5 dazu. right kennt mal wieder keiner richtig.

        Für IE habe deshalb ins Stylesheet

        body { margin-width:0px; margin-height:0px; margin-left:0px; margin-right:0px; margin-top:0px;} verwendet.

        »»

        es genügt: margin:0;

        Das overflow kenne ich noch nicht, wozu ist das genau gut ?

        als Einstieg:
        <../../tdch.htm#a13>

        Grüße
        Thomas